Murder on the Celtic
Previously published under the name Conrad Allen, the Ocean Liner series is relaunched for a new generation of readers.
George Dillman and Genevieve Masefield have crossed the Atlantic Ocean numerous times in their capacity as ship's detectives. On several of those crossings, they've had the pleasure, and in some cases the trouble, of sailing with some very famous passengers.
Dukes. Duchesses. Artists. Actors. Musicians. Kings and queens. But few names have quite the level of fame and fortune as their fellow traveller Sir Arthur Conan Doyle. Will the famous writer help or hinder them?
Murder on the Celtic presents a thrilling chapter in the adventures of Dillman and Masefield as they navigate the high seas, combining mystery and intrigue with a touch of historical charm.

About the Author
Edward Marston has written over a hundred books across many series. They range from the era of the Domesday Book to the Home Front during W W I, via Elizabethan theatre and the Regency period. He is best know n for the hugely
successful Railway Detective series set during Queen Victoria's reign.
